Outside Market and Speculation Driving Volatility but Supply Fundamentals Continue to Underpin Pork Product Pricing
Posted on: February 26, 2025
Lean hog futures have been volatile in the last three months as market participants try to price the potential impact of tariffs on Mexico and Canada while also recognizing that spot supply is lower than expected.
